Banana Graham Dessert Recipe
  • Prep: 20 min. + chilling
  • Yield: 9 Servings
20 20

Ingredients

  • 1 package (1.5 ounces) instant sugar-free vanilla pudding mix
  • 2-3/4 cups fat-free milk
  • 1 cup (8 ounces) fat-free sour cream
  • 12 whole reduced-fat graham crackers
  • 2 large firm bananas, sliced

Directions

  • In a bowl, beat pudding mix and milk on low speed for 2 minutes. Fold in sour cream. Let stand for 5 minutes. In a 3-qt. bowl, layer a third of the graham crackers, bananas and pudding mixture. Repeat layers twice. Refrigerate. Yield: 9 servings.

Diabetic Exchanges: One 1/2-cup serving equals 1-1/2 starch; also, 114 calories, 141 mg sodium, 4 mg cholesterol, 22 gm carbohydrate, 5 gm protein, 1 gm fat.
